We are seeking a detail-focused Commercial Settlement Analyst to support settlement activities for International Voice Carriers. In this role, the individual will manage monthly settlements, analyse bilateral deal positions, and deliver accurate reporting while identifying risks and opportunities to enhance cash flow and profitability. The position is ideal for someone with accounting experience, strong analytical skills, and the ability to collaborate effectively across diverse internal and external stakeholders.
Job Responsibility:
Prepare monthly settlements, bilateral deal positions, and deal true-ups at the end of each deal period in line with operational priorities
Manage a designated portfolio of carriers, ensuring timely settlements and resolving billing or settlement disputes
Collaborate with Commercial, Legal, Technical Integrity, Reporting, and external partners to proactively address issues and deliver optimal outcomes
Contribute to departmental KPIs while supporting team members and preventing single points of failure
Ensure accurate revenue and cost reporting, including capturing disputes, risks, and opportunities
Requirements:
Experienced in accounting functions within large, process-based industries, ideally telecoms
Skilled at communicating with finance and non-finance stakeholders, both internally and externally
Comfortable working with international partners and using culturally sensitive communication styles
Knowledgeable in commercial settlement processes
Advanced in Microsoft Excel, including pivot tables and complex formulas
Part-qualified or newly qualified accountant, or you bring equivalent industry experience
